Transaction efbf98757ab29c6e89b0f4fba7f3e3205c8e6adbc4570b990d6b4babc9ff59ef
1 Input
1 Output
-
efbf98757ab29c6e89b0f4fba7f3e3205c8e6adbc4570b990d6b4babc9ff59ef:0
- value
- 66675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d9b560430332969985ffa55b8bc69092c1d257b OP_EQUAL
- address
- 3MtmLsaaXgheg67BT6Pn4zC1Vbny3TK5cc